bh Marking a significant step towards clean energy adoption, Domestic Piped Natural Gas (DPNG) supply was formally launched at N-6 area of IRC Village in Nayapalli area recently.
The initiative has been implemented as part of the National PNG Drive 2.0, aimed at expanding access to piped natural gas across urban households.
The DPNG supply was inaugurated by Bhubaneswar Member of Parliament (MP) Aparajita Sarangi, who attended the event as the Chief Guest. The programme witnessed participation from local residents and officials associated with the project.
Kausik Das, General Manager (CGD) and Officer-in-Charge, Bhubaneswar, along with other GAIL CGD officials, highlighted the benefits of Domestic Piped Natural Gas. He outlined the roadmap to extend PNG connections to every household in the locality.
Addressing the gathering, the MP shared her personal experience as a DPNG user and encouraged residents to adopt the cleaner fuel alternative. She emphasised key benefits such as enhanced safety, uninterrupted supply, convenience, and cost-effectiveness.
The rollout of DPNG in Nayapalli is expected to boost the adoption of eco-friendly energy solutions and contribute to a greener urban environment in the capital city.
